- Abstract: This paper studies the formation of singularities in classical solutions to the compressible Euler equations for a Chaplygin gas. We give several sufficient conditions on the initial data to obtain that the density itself of the classical solutions to the Cauchy problem for both 1D Chaplygin gas equations and 2D axisymmetric Chaplygin gas equations blows up in finite time.
